关于本文
本文是论文 SoK (Summary of Knowledge): Play-to-Earn Projects的解读。该论文英文版由清华博士生Jingfan Yu,上海交通大学博士生Mengqian Zhang,纽约大学斯特恩商学院教授Xi Chen,和清华大学教授 Zhixuan Fang共同完成。英文版发布在arXiv (https://arxiv.org/abs/2211.01000) 。中文稿由纽约大学Violet Venture Club Sherry Wang负责撰写,Essie Yang负责校对。
本文从经济、治理和实施方面围绕 Play-to-Earn 项目展开探讨,分析了如何借助区块链技术使 Play-to-Earn 项目受益于代币流通和去中心化治理,根据不同程度的稳健性和透明度对 Play-to-Earn 项目的实施进行分类,最后进一步讨论了未来研究中可能在攻击、代币经济和治理等方面面临的安全和社会挑战。
引言
区块链的发展,尤其是同质化代币(Fungible Tokens,简称FTs)、非同质化代币(Non-Fungible Tokens,简称NFTs)和去中心化金融(DeFi)的出现,正在见证着GameFi 市场的崛起。GameFi 是 Game Finance 的缩写,被译为游戏化金融,其运行在区块链之上,旨在将游戏本身的乐趣与金融元素相结合。依托于底层的区块链技术,GameFi 项目与传统游戏不同,具有系统稳健、透明度高、代币流通范围广和去中心化治理的特点。
Play-to-Earn(简称P2E)游戏是典型的 GameFi 项目。顾名思义,在 P2E 游戏中,玩家可以边玩边赚取代币奖励,游戏内的资产(如虚拟土地、人物和角色皮肤)、货币(如宝石、积分和硬币)等均可采用加密代币的形式,各类 DeFi 项目也为它们的交易提供了二级市场。这些代币的所有权信息、交易信息以及游戏本身的智能合约实现都存储在区块链上,游戏公司可以直接使用以太坊这样的公有链,也可以专门搭建自己的私有链。
P2E 模式已经吸引了市场和投资者的极大关注。到 2022 年 9 月,有超过 90 万个活跃钱包与 P2E 游戏项目进行交互,并发送了超过 2000 万笔交易。Axie Infinity 是目前最受欢迎的 DeFi 游戏之一,它允许玩家收集、饲养、繁殖、战斗、交易被称作 Axies 的数字宠物,并在这个过程中赚取代币奖励,该游戏的总 NFT 交易量超过 20 亿美元,高峰期达到 280 万月活跃用户。然而另一方面,P2E 游戏的高回报和高进入成本也招来了许多批评的声音,一些人认为这些项目存在经济泡沫,有些人甚至称这些项目是加密庞氏骗局。
本文作为第一篇系统回顾 P2E 项目的文章,将从经济、治理、安全的角度解析P2E游戏,并探讨其面临的挑战。
01 代币经济
如前所述,P2E 游戏中通常有多种代币。例如,Axie Infinity 采用双币种模型,使用了两个主要代币:AXS 和 SLP,其中 AXS 是该游戏平台的原生治理代币,其总发行量是有限,而 SLP 的总供应量是无限的,主要供玩家在游戏中使用。
P2E游戏中的代币主要有以下功能,用于融资(Funding)、支付(Payment)、治理投票(Voting)、激励玩家(Incentive for players)、激励投资者(Incentive for investors)、方便玩家原创内容的交易(Tokenize UGC)、激励用户为系统做贡献(Incentive for implementation)、作为权益证明(Stake proof for consensus)等。
表1总结了一些热门的 P2E 游戏中的代币设计。可以发现,每个项目都可以通过其代币设计来刻画,例如是否使用不同的代币作为对玩家和投资者的激励、治理代币是否可以通过游戏获得、以及是否存在不能通过游戏获得的代币等等。在游戏中,一个代币可以用于实现多种目的,也可以给多个代币赋予同一功能,这使得游戏开发者可以将具有各种特性的代币组合起来,设计出与众不同的项目,应对复杂的游戏生态。
02 治理模型
以项目代币作为媒介,P2E 游戏通常会经历从无到有、从中心化到去中心化的演变过程。最初,游戏公司是唯一的代币持有者,会在首次代币发行(Initial Coin Offering,简称ICO)阶段将一些游戏代币出售给投资者以获取资金。通常来说,投资者愿意参与主要是期待所购买的代币未来会升值并带来高回报,另一方面,如果这些ICO代币同时是该项目的治理代币,那么投资者也将获得未来管理该游戏的潜在权利。
随着游戏的搭建与运行,各种游戏代币不断生成、并分散在各个参与者的手中。简单来说,玩家可以在游戏中铸造 NFTs 并拿到市场上租赁或出售,投资者可以质押自己的代币来赚取利息。在这个过程中,系统会从相关经济活动中抽取一定的交易费放到一个公共账号中,并在需要时再分配给游戏生态中的参与者。除了 ICO 代币,NFTs 或其他项目代币也可能作为治理代币。因此在第二阶段,玩家也将持有治理代币,然而此时,项目仍然是由游戏公司管理。
理想情况下,系统最终会演化到第三阶段,即完全由包括玩家和投资者在内的治理代币持有者管理,将治理权委托给社区。参与者将通过投票为游戏的发展做出决策,例如,投票表决是否向游戏添加某个新功能、设置多少奖金来吸引人实现这一功能。因此,在这一阶段,玩家可以额外通过参与游戏实现来赚钱。而原始的游戏公司作为治理代币持有者,将以玩家或投资者的身份参与项目治理,并通过与游戏交互、质押代币或者做贡献的方式来赚取更多代币。
03 实现方式
P2E 项目有各种类型的数据需要存储,例如游戏协议、玩家的行为、玩家原创内容(User-Generated Content,简称UGC)、资产所有权和各种证明等。
根据是否使用中心化的服务器,可以将 P2E 项目分为完全去中心化实现和去中心化与中心化相结合的混合实现。对于前者,考虑到不断增长的游戏数据带来的存储成本,通常只要求所有节点共同维护资产所有权、UGC哈希值等关键数据,其他数据则仅由部分节点保存。而对于后者,引入中心化的服务器来存储和处理部分数据,一方面可以方便游戏公司不断迭代修改游戏设计,另一方面,由于混合架构对网络吞吐量和数据处理速度的要求要低得多,它可以提供更好的性能和游戏体验。
除此之外,原文还对项目是否依赖公链、有无许可权限、共识设计以及子系统之间的连接展开了分类讨论,并在表2进行了简要的总结。不同的实现方式各有利弊,也反映了项目的设计原则,例如去中心化程度、透明度、稳健性、性能等方面之间的权衡。
04 面临挑战
当前,P2E 游戏的设计与实现仍面临诸多挑战。
安全挑战
同其他区块链项目一样,P2E 游戏也可能会出现安全问题。一些去中心化程度不高并且存放大量资金的账号(例如跨链桥、游戏中的公共账号)容易受到黑客攻击。一个典型的例子是2022 年 3 月 29 日,Axie Infinity 所依赖的 Ronin 链(一条以太坊的私有侧链)遭到攻击,超过半数共识节点的私钥被破解,攻击者将大量加密货币通过跨链桥转移到以太坊链上,造成超过 6.25 亿美元的损失。
由于游戏协议是以智能合约的形式公开部署在链上,一些设计和实施上的漏洞也会被参与者恶意利用。例如在 Cryptozoon 中,玩家可以购买一个游戏中的“蛋”来孵化得到一个具有随机稀有度的 ZOAN NFT,为获得理想的NFT,攻击者在触发孵化函数时检查所得 ZOAN 的稀有度,如果等级太低则进行回滚,直到获得最为稀有的 ZOAN。通过将随机性与回滚相结合,攻击者严重破坏了游戏的公平性。
除了上述私钥泄露和智能合约漏洞,P2E 项目也存在 ICO 诈骗、NFT 内容无法访问等风险。
经济挑战
区块链的高交易费用和潜在用户对区块链技术的不熟悉可能会在吸引游戏玩家时造成壁垒。为了解决这一问题,P2E 项目可以同时在公链、私链和中心化服务器上部署游戏,并在它们之间搭建跨链桥,让玩家能够以较低的成本加入游戏。
随着越来越的玩家加入,参与者将获得越来越多的游戏代币,尤其是那些可以通过游戏轻松获得、总发行量不限的代币(例如 Axie Infinity 中的 SLP),这样一来,代币价格将不断下跌,可能导致玩家集体弃局。为保持稳定,设计者一般会调整游戏设计以减少这些代币的供应或引入新活动来增加其消耗。更根本的,可以通过仔细设计代币模型、交换机制等来吸引不同风险偏好的投资者和不同游玩成本的玩家,进而吸引更多的资金与用户。
在区块链中,用户可以轻松借出闪电贷。因此,任何人都可以创建多个账户并在它们之间转移代币。这些虚拟交易可以带来巨大的交易量并造成价格扭曲:一些统计网站(如 CoinMarketCap)是按照交易量对 P2E 项目进行排名,交易量越大,项目排名越靠前,在潜在投资者和参与者面前的曝光度就越高;此外,一组相似的 NFT 的价格是根据其销售价格的平均值来计算的,高价的虚拟交易将影响这些 NFT 的估值。然而,目前还没有有效的机制来应对解决 NFT 虚拟交易。
治理挑战
如前所述,P2E 项目会经历中心化阶段和去中心化阶段。目前已经完全实现去中心化治理的项目占比不高,何时过渡为去中心化、去中心化治理的效率与公平性等都有待研究。
中心化阶段主要由游戏公司进行决策,但 P2E 项目中存在着只有玩家才拥有的代币(例如 Axie Infinity 中的 SLP),由于游戏公司不持有此类代币,它可能会做出损害这些代币持有者利益的决定。 例如,游戏公司可能会更新游戏、限制这些代币的使用,发行新代币以吸引新玩家、同时令原有代币贬值。此外,大部分P2E项目并没有在智能合约中明确何时以及如何进入去中心化阶段,游戏公司可能会以去中心化治理作为噱头、但无限推迟权力下放的时间。
进入去中心化阶段之后,P2E 项目将广泛采用提案和多数投票的方案,游戏世界中的任何参与者都可以进行提案并为之投票,他们的投票根据持有的代币加权汇总。在这一过程中,投票的安全和隐私、治理的效率和公平、以及如何避免“公地悲剧”等都是去中心化阶段需要面临和解决的挑战。例如,在分配公共账户中的代币时,持有大量代币的玩家存在动机支持对他们有利的决定,这样一来,富人会变得更富,这与公平性是背道而驰的。
此外,纵览 P2E 市场,大量项目都声称可以让玩家真正拥有他们在游戏世界中的数字资产,这些项目的实现各不相同,然而当前还没有关于“所有权”的明确定义,更没有对项目设计质量进行衡量的判断标准,亟需明确的行业规范从源头帮助打造安全、经济和治理设计愈加完善的 P2E 游戏。